My understanding of the previous comments is that "active regeneration" utilizes a 4th injection vent that shoots fuel during the exhaust stroke and "passive regeneration" is just running your pickup hot enough to burn the filter contents without adding fuel. I would've thought that active regen would've meant sending some fuel directly to the canister??? I also have this oil dilution problem and it doesn't make me a happy camper. Well yes, the 4th injection event technically sends fuel directly to the canister. The fuel is still raw when its exhausted by the exhaust stoke. Saves from having to have a separate fuel system that injects directly into the canister.
